Ugram Viram Mahavishnum

उग्रं वीरं महाविष्णुं

Devanagari

उग्रं वीरं महाविष्णुं ज्वलन्तं सर्वतोमुखम् । नृसिंहं भीषणं भद्रं मृत्युमृत्युं नमाम्यहम् ॥

Transliteration

Ugram viram mahavishnum jvalantam sarvato-mukham · Nrisimham bhishanam bhadram mrityur-mrityum namamy-aham

Meaning

I bow to Narasimha — the fierce, the heroic, the great Vishnu — blazing in every direction, terrifying yet auspicious, the death of death itself.

When & why

The most-recited Narasimha shloka in the Vaishnava tradition. Use as a protection prayer before sleep or before any threatening situation.

Traditional benefits

Said to grant fearlessness in the face of impossible odds. The "mrityu-mrityu" shloka.
